Here's a heartwarming story about a father bailing out his son and making a big profit on the transaction.

The father is Li Ka-shing, the son is Richard Li Tzar-kai.

About nine years ago, Prince Richard took over a prime Tokyo commercial site for HK$5.82 billion.

The market had been sluggish for a long time and not even zero interest rates could revive it. So Li the younger's private arm Pacific Century Group ended up selling a 45 per cent stake to the father's Hutchison Whampoa at a steep discount of HK$1.45 billion.

Advertisement

An office and hotel project was launched on the site in November 2001 and again the response in the market was tepid.
